Kogi SA on Labour Matters praises Gov. Ododo for payment of workers salaries, Pension on 24th April.

The Special Adviser on Labour Matters to Kogi State Governor, Comr. Onuh Edoka has sent a message of appreciation to Gov Usman Ahmed Ododo for keeping faith with the prompt payment of salaries.

Comr. Edoka in a statement issued to Newsmen in Lokoja, described the commitment of Gov Ododo to the regular payment of workers as a sign of better things to come, urged the workers to keep faith with the administration.

The Special Adviser disclosed that since his assumption office, the Governor has kept faith with the payment of salaries and pension at both the Local Government and in the State level.

The Special Adviser said in his interactions with many workers and Pensioners, said they are very happy with the prompt payment of salaries and Pension, look forward with hope and optimism that the Governor will sustained the unprecedented feat.

He expressed appreciation that no worker and Pensioner in the State is presently being owed salary by the present administration, expressed optimism that more goodies await workers in the State.

He appealed to the workers to show more patient and understanding with the present administration, described Gov. Ododo as workers friendly Governor.
